DY4 0DJ is a safe, established residential area on Hopton Close, 0.7km from Ocker Hill in Tipton. Administratively it sits within Princes End ward and the West Bromwich West constituency.

This is a strong family neighbourhood — a stable, owner-occupied suburb — married couples, UK-born, strong community. The daytime character shifts — non-white workforce in manufacturing and transport. The 43 average age reflects a mixed, mid-career community — settling down but not yet slowing down. 86%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 22 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: With prices averaging £140k, this is one of the more affordable postcodes in the area, up 75.6% year-on-year.

Census 2021 statistics for DY4 0DJ are sourced from Output Area E00050733 (shared with 5 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
